(a) Intent. The RR Zone is intended to provide for low density residential development in outlying and rural areas in a form which creates a stable and attractive residential environment. The specific intent in establishing this zone is:

(1) To separate residential structures to an extent which will:

(A) Preserve the rural, open quality of the environment;

(B) Prevent health hazards in areas not served by public water and sewer.

(2) To prohibit uses which would:

(A) Violate the residential character of the environment;

(B) Generate heavy traffic in predominantly residential areas.
